Bi, Don't Be Afraid (2011)
Original title: Bi, đừng sợ!
Bi, Don't Be Afraid is a 2011 Vietnamese-language drama movie directed by Phan Đăng Di, with a running time of 1h 30m. It stars Thanh Minh Phan, Kiều Trinh and Nguyen Ha Phong.
In an old house in Hanoi, Bi, a 6-year-old child lives with his parents, his aunt and their cook. His favorite playgrounds are an ice factory and the wild grass along the river. After being absent for years, his grandfather, seriously ill, reappears and settles at their house. While Bi gets closer to his grandfather, his father tries to avoid any contact with his family. Every night, he gets drunk and goes and see his masseuse, for whom he feels a quiet strong desire. Bi's mother turns a blind eye on it. The aunt, still single, meets a 16-year-old young boy in the bus. Her attraction to him moves her deeply.
